什么是阿里语音识别?
阿里语音识别是由阿里巴巴开发的一种语音处理技术,可以将语音转换为文本。它广泛应用于智能助手、语音搜索、语音命令等场景。其技术基础依赖于深度学习和自然语言处理,使得语音识别的准确性和效率不断提高。
阿里语音识别的特点
- 高准确率:通过深度学习算法提高识别率。
- 多语种支持:支持多种语言,满足国际化需求。
- 实时识别:支持实时语音识别,适合语音交互应用。
- 开源:提供GitHub项目,方便开发者使用和修改。
阿里语音识别的GitHub项目
项目地址
阿里语音识别的开源项目可以在GitHub上找到。相关项目包括了示例代码和使用文档。
如何安装阿里语音识别
-
克隆仓库:使用以下命令克隆项目: bash git clone https://github.com/alibaba/voice-recognition.git
-
安装依赖:在项目目录下运行: bash npm install
-
运行项目:执行: bash npm start
如何使用阿里语音识别
基本用法
-
导入库:在你的JavaScript代码中导入阿里语音识别库。 javascript import VoiceRecognition from ‘voice-recognition’;
-
初始化识别:创建识别实例并配置参数。 javascript const recognition = new VoiceRecognition(); recognition.lang = ‘zh-CN’;
-
开始识别:调用开始识别的方法。 javascript recognition.start();
处理结果
使用事件监听器来处理识别结果: javascript recognition.onresult = (event) => { const transcript = event.results[0][0].transcript; console.log(‘识别结果:’, transcript); };
常见问题解答(FAQ)
阿里语音识别支持哪些语言?
阿里语音识别支持多种语言,包括中文、英文、西班牙语等多种主流语言。具体语言支持可以在GitHub项目文档中查看。
如何提高识别准确率?
- 使用清晰的音频:确保音频质量良好,背景噪音尽量减少。
- 调整模型参数:根据需要调整语音识别模型的参数,以适应特定场景。
- 提供上下文信息:对于特定领域的应用,提供更多上下文信息可以提高准确性。
阿里语音识别的API有免费使用额度吗?
是的,阿里语音识别的API提供了一定的免费使用额度,具体使用条款可以参考阿里云官方文档。
在GitHub上如何贡献代码?
开发者可以通过以下步骤参与贡献:
- Fork项目:在GitHub上fork阿里语音识别项目。
- 修改代码:在自己的分支上进行代码修改。
- 提交Pull Request:完成修改后提交Pull Request。
结论
阿里语音识别作为一个功能强大的开源项目,在GitHub上为开发者提供了丰富的资源和支持。通过合理使用和贡献代码,我们可以推动语音识别技术的进一步发展。希望本文对你理解和使用阿里语音识别有所帮助。